You in the U.S.? If so, I had good luck with Bitcoin-Brokers (some thread on services which I'm to lazy to look up.) Got through about $5k in a few days of light work, and the buyers were happy also. Got good prices there, but that was not my top priority.
Bitcoin-Brokers stopped taking on new sellers for a while, and I wanted to make some larger single sales so after a bit of time trying unsuccessfully to arrange a suitable local transaction, I signed up with Coinbase. I thought I was going to have to give them high quality scans of my identity documents which I don't like to set free into the wild, but it turns out that that was not the case. For the past three weeks or so I've been using them and am really happy with their service as well.
To contrast, Mt. Gox happily took my identity theft kit back in Aug but neglected to tell me that they cannot service U.S. customers. They've been sitting on my $5k wire for more than a quarter now. I don't recomend them, and more importantly, I caution against regarding anything they say as being especially truthful.
